The Latest Developments in Maternal Mental Health for Obstetric Providers Webinar & Roundtable Discussion

Thursday, November 30, 2023, 1-2pm PT

If you are a midwife, OB/Gyn, or family practice provider who delivers babies, we invite you to register to join us for a live (and recorded) presentation walking through the latest developments impacting obstetric providers in maternal mental health (MMH). This will include a review of the HEDIS prenatal and postpartum depression screening and follow-up measures and Alliance for Innovation in Maternal Health Care’s perinatal depression “bundle.” We will also introduce two new MMH resources (and one refreshed) developed by the Policy Center with you in mind:

A screening script (words to use to help expecting and postpartum patients feel at ease)

A refreshed menu of treatment options (including zuranolone and more)

Billing and reimbursement guidance (derived from the new HEDIS screening and follow-up specifications)

The session will include time for a roundtable discussion.
